WebSep 26, 2024 · Light Bulb Color Types. Soft white : Bulbs rated at 2700-3000 Kelvin typically produce a more yellowish light, which is best used in bedrooms and living rooms. Warm white : Bulbs rated at 3000-4000 Kelvin produce a yellowish, white light that is best used in kitchens, bedrooms, and bathrooms. WebApr 23, 2024 · Incandescent bulbs roughly last 2,000 hours. Fluorescent bulbs extend that to 4,000 hours. LED lamps last 10,000+ hours for inexpensive lamps and up to 50,000 hours for some of them. I just bought a 6-pack of LED Edison style (the old fashion lightbulbs) for $9.99 at the grocery store. The color temperature of the electromagnetic radiation emitted from an ideal black body is defined as its surface temperature in kelvins, or alternatively in micro reciprocal degrees (mired). This permits the definition of a standard by which light sources are compared.
